Not really. If you bother to wander over to TBYNet and peruse the threads concerning RK tractors and their issues with service and warranty after the sale, you will see they have ongoing issues.

The problem is (with Rural King), is that you while you can sell tractors at retail farm stores, issues arise concerning warranty service because most of those stores cannot perform warranty service. In fact, RK only has 2 places that do, Waverly, Ohio and someplace way down south so if you require warranty mechanical service, your options are very limited.

Granted, it's hard to beat Rural King's price per PTO horsepower on tractors and so long as the units remain 100% issue free, all well and good, but if they don't, the end user could be in for quite an unpleasant experience.

My brother in law has a bunch of those heated jackets/sweatshirts and loves them. He does HVAC so he is outside in all types of weather. One negative he has is that the battery packs tends to weigh it down and cause the garment to sag over time. The positive? His company runs all Milwaukee tools and provides extra battery packs at no cost.

For me, all my cordless tools are Ryobi and it would necessitate an investment in additional batteries and chargers just to use the garments.
